    This presentation distinguishes correlation from causation by highlighting how conditional probability and unobserved confounders can artificially create or reverse trends, a flaw particularly prevalent in psychology and semi-autonomous vehicle research. The speaker illustrates these statistical pitfalls through case studies where uncontrolled variables obscure the true drivers of fatigue in autonomous systems, preventing reliable causal inference from observational data. By tracing the historical roots of experimental design to ancient Babylon and critiquing the current lack of mathematical frameworks for causal asymmetry, the discussion underscores the enduring challenge of deriving causality from purely statistical relationships.

    Turing Award winner Judea Pearl argues that artificial intelligence must evolve from statistical correlation to causal reasoning to achieve true intelligence, introducing the "do-calculus" to mathematically distinguish between observation and intervention. His framework utilizes causal graphs and counterfactuals to enable machines to understand responsibility, ethics, and self-modeling, thereby addressing the limitations of current deep learning systems. Pearl envisions a future where AI integrates human-provided qualitative models with quantitative data to solve complex problems, while warning of the existential risks posed by creating autonomous systems that could surpass human control.
